Best AI IDE Enhancement Tools
Tools that enhance integrated development environments (IDEs) with AI capabilities, improving coding efficiency, collaboration, and productivity.
30 tools in this category
About AI IDE Enhancement Tools
AI IDE enhancement tools are designed to integrate artificial intelligence capabilities into integrated development environments (IDEs), transforming the way developers code. These tools leverage machine learning algorithms to assist with code completion, error detection, and suggestions, ultimately improving coding efficiency and collaboration among team members. With the rapid advancement of technology, developers increasingly rely on AI-driven tools to streamline their workflow and enhance productivity.
One of the primary reasons to use AI IDE enhancement tools is their ability to significantly reduce the time spent on coding tasks. By providing real-time suggestions and automating mundane coding processes, developers can focus on more complex problems that require critical thinking. Furthermore, these tools can facilitate better collaboration among team members by ensuring that everyone adheres to the same coding standards and practices. Whether you are a solo developer or part of a larger team, AI IDE enhancements can create a more cohesive coding environment.
When considering AI IDE enhancement tools, there are several key features to look for. First, intelligent code completion is essential, as it can save time and reduce errors by suggesting the next lines of code based on context. Another important feature is error detection and debugging assistance, which helps identify and fix code issues before they become problematic. Additionally, look for collaboration features that allow multiple team members to work on the same project seamlessly. The integration of these tools with popular IDEs, such as Visual Studio and JetBrains, is also crucial for ensuring a smooth user experience.
Choosing the right AI IDE enhancement tool involves evaluating your specific needs and workflow. Consider the programming languages you primarily use and ensure the tool supports them. It’s also beneficial to look for tools that offer customization options, allowing you to tailor the AI assistance to your coding style. User reviews and case studies can provide valuable insights into how well the tool performs in real-world scenarios. Lastly, many tools offer free trials, giving you a chance to test their capabilities before making a commitment.
In summary, AI IDE enhancement tools are invaluable for developers seeking to improve their coding efficiency and productivity. With a variety of options available, such as Tabnine, Visual Studio IntelliCode, Codeium, Cursor, and Raycast AI, finding the right tool can make all the difference in your development process. By leveraging AI technology, you can streamline your workflow and enhance collaboration, ultimately leading to better software outcomes and a more satisfying coding experience.